Key Vocabulary & Phrases
- Single-threaded - Refers to a processing model where a single sequence of instructions is executed.
- In-memory - Describes a system that stores data in RAM for quick access, resulting in low latency.
- Data structure - A particular way to organize and store data in a computer.
- Atomicity - A property ensuring that a series of operations are completed without interference, treating them as a single unit.
- Latency - The time delay between a request and the corresponding response.
- Pipelining - A technique that allows multiple commands to be sent at once, improving efficiency.
- Durability - Refers to the ability of a system to maintain data integrity even after failures.
- Command execution - The process of carrying out a specific task or instruction within a system.

What is the Shadowing Technique?
Shadowing is a science-backed language learning technique originally developed for professional interpreter training and popularized by polyglot Dr. Alexander Arguelles. The method is simple but powerful: you listen to native English audio and immediately repeat it out loud — like a shadow following the speaker with just a 1–2 second delay. Unlike passive listening or grammar drills, shadowing forces your brain and mouth muscles to simultaneously process and reproduce real speech patterns. Research shows it significantly improves pronunciation accuracy, intonation, rhythm, connected speech, listening comprehension, and speaking fluency — making it one of the most effective methods for IELTS Speaking preparation and real-world English communication.
